Abstract

According to a water pillow for heat radiation for touching a heat generating object, absorbing heat from the heat generating object and radiating heat by cooling liquid that circulates inside the water pillow, said device includes an inflow inlet for flowing the cooling liquid inside the water pillow, a drain outlet for flowing the cooling liquid out of inside the water pillow, a plurality of cooling fins spoke wise disposed on a first plane constituting a cavity inside the water pillow where the cooling liquid circulates and an impeller for circulating in a whirl the cooling liquid disposed on a second plane opposed in parallel or almost parallel with the first plane.

1 . A water pillow for heat radiation for touching a heat generating object, absorbing heat from the heat generating object and radiating heat by cooling liquid that circulates inside the water pillow, comprising:
 an inflow inlet for flowing the cooling liquid inside the water pillow;   a drain outlet for flowing the cooling liquid out of inside the water pillow;   a plurality of cooling fins spokewise disposed on a first plane constituting a cavity inside the water pillow where the cooling liquid circulates; and   an impeller for circulating in a whirl the cooling liquid disposed on a second plane opposed in parallel or almost parallel with the first plane.   
   
   
       2 . The water pillow for heat radiation according to  claim 1 , wherein
 each of said cooling fins spokewise disposed on the first plane forms a circular arc or almost circular arc forming a curved line in a circulating direction of the cooling liquid that circulates in a whirl inside the water pillow.   
   
   
       3 . The water pillow for heat radiation according to  claim 1 , wherein
 each of said cooling fins spokewise disposed on the first plane forms an elevation angle which is formed between the first plane and the cooling fin and which is formed on a side where the cooling liquid that circulates in a whirl inside the water pillow is directly applied.   
   
   
       4 . The water pillow for heat radiation according to  claim 1 , wherein
 each of said cooling fins spokewise disposed on the first plane has a cross-section cut along a plane orthogonal to the cooling fin and the first plane which shows a form of concave circular arc or almost circular arc on a side where the cooling liquid that circulates in a whirl inside the water pillow is directly applied.   
   
   
       5 . The water pillow for heat radiation according to  claim 4 , wherein
 said cooling fin forms a larger circular arc or almost circular arc or plane in a farther outer circumference side of the radiation.   
   
   
       6 . The water pillow for heat radiation according to  claim 4 , wherein
 height of said cooling fin from the first plane increases in a farther outer circumference side of the radiation.   
   
   
       7 . The water pillow for heat radiation according to  claim 1 , wherein
 said cooling fins are a group of sets of a plurality of cooling fins having different height.   
   
   
       8 . The water pillow for heat radiation according to  claim 7 , wherein
 said cooling fins are disposed in such a way that the height of the cooling fins gradually increases along a circulating direction of the cooling liquid that circulates in a whirl inside the water pillow.   
   
   
       9 . A cooling device provided with a water pillow for heat radiation for touching a heat generating object, absorbing heat from the heat generating object and radiating heat by cooling liquid that circulates inside the water pillow, said device comprising:
 a water pillow comprising:
 an inflow inlet for flowing the cooling liquid inside the water pillow; 
 a drain outlet for flowing the cooling liquid out of inside the water pillow; and 
 a cavity which is inside the water pillow that circulates the cooling liquid and which includes a plurality of cooling fins spokewise disposed on a first plane constituting the cavity and an impeller disposed on a second plane opposed in parallel or almost parallel with the first plane for circulating the cooling liquid in a whirl, and 
   a pump for flowing the cooling liquid in the flow inlet, flowing the cooling liquid out of the drain outlet and circulating the cooling liquid in the cavity.
